Short answer: Farro generally edges out common whole wheat on fiber, mineral density (magnesium, iron, zinc), and slower blood-sugar response, while whole wheat typically provides slightly more protein and is more widely available and versatile; which "wins" depends on your specific goal-fiber and micronutrients (choose farro), broad protein or pantry access (choose wheat).

Key takeaways, at a glance
- Farro's micronutrient density - Farro routinely reports higher concentrations of certain minerals and antioxidants per cooked cup versus typical whole wheat, making it a strong choice when micronutrients matter.
- Fiber and satiety - Both grains are high in fiber; farro often yields slightly higher soluble fiber per cooked serving, supporting satiety and stable blood sugar.
- Protein - Whole wheat usually provides comparable or slightly higher protein per cup than farro, but neither is a complete protein; pairing with legumes completes amino profiles.
- Glycemic impact - Farro's lower glycemic index (GI ≈ 40-45) typically gives it an edge for blood-sugar control over some wheat varieties (GI ≈ 45-55).
- Allergy note - Both are forms of wheat and contain gluten, so neither is appropriate for celiac disease or confirmed non-celiac gluten sensitivity.
Historical and scientific context
Ancient origins - Farro (emmer, einkorn, spelt) traces to the Fertile Crescent and was a staple in early Mediterranean and Roman diets; modern nutritional interest resurged in the late 20th and early 21st centuries as whole-grain science emphasized long-term health benefits.
Modern evidence - Systematic reviews linking whole-grain intake to reduced cardiovascular disease, type 2 diabetes, and lower all-cause mortality underpin recommendations to prefer whole forms like farro or whole wheat over refined grain products in routine diets.

Practical nutrition strategies
Portion control - Use a ¼-½ cup (dry) portion guideline for cooked servings to balance carbohydrate load while getting fiber and nutrients from either grain.
Complementary pairing - Combine farro or whole wheat with legumes, nuts, or seeds to reach a more complete amino-acid profile and add healthy fats.

Evidence-based numeric details
Population associations - Meta-analyses summarized by whole-grain advocacy and academic reviews indicate that consuming three or more servings of whole grains per day (serving ≈ ½ cup cooked) is associated with a 10-20% lower risk of coronary heart disease over 10-20 years in large cohort studies; whole farro or wheat both contribute to this protective effect.
Measured GI and fiber - Farro's GI is typically cited near 40-45, while many whole-wheat products fall 45-55; a cooked cup providing 6-8 g fiber supplies roughly 20-30% of the EU/EFSA daily fiber target of 25 g (adult average) depending on portion size.

Notes, limitations, and final considerations
Data variability - Exact nutrient numbers vary by cultivar, soil, processing (pearled vs whole), and cooking method; published ranges above reflect aggregated reported values from nutrition databases and extension publications.
Medical caution - Both are wheat species containing gluten and should be avoided by people with celiac disease or diagnosed gluten sensitivity; always consult a registered dietitian for individualized medical nutrition therapy.

Is farro healthier than wheat?
"Healthier" depends on the metric: farro often offers higher micronutrients and a slightly lower glycemic index, while whole wheat may provide a small protein edge and greater availability; both are superior to refined grain forms for long-term health outcomes.
Can eating farro help with weight control?
Farro's high fiber and moderate protein increase satiety, and population studies associate higher whole-grain intake with lower BMI; no single grain guarantees weight loss, but farro can support weight-management diets when used in controlled portions.
Do farro and wheat have the same gluten content?
Both farro varieties and modern wheat contain gluten; they are not safe for people with celiac disease or confirmed gluten intolerance-farro is simply a different wheat species rather than a gluten-free alternative.
Which has more fiber?
Per cooked cup both grains are high in fiber; published comparisons often show farro and wheat berries in the same ballpark (about 6-9 g per cooked cup), with some sources reporting farro slightly higher in soluble fiber and wheat slightly higher in total fiber depending on variety and processing.
How should I cook farro versus wheat?
Pearled or semi-pearled farro takes 15-25 minutes; whole farro takes 35-40 minutes; wheat berries (whole wheat) typically take 40-60 minutes unless soaked overnight-rinsing and simmering in 2-3 cups water per cup grain is common practice.
